Transaction 57e80e8ace614fb520ba31169474369876c136d2c991ea771d9b561e0b2fc776
1 Input
2 Outputs
- 57e80e8ace614fb520ba31169474369876c136d2c991ea771d9b561e0b2fc776:0
- 57e80e8ace614fb520ba31169474369876c136d2c991ea771d9b561e0b2fc776:1
value 919958
address 1H3xYAPEvjNpYHxXxnbHPQC47VPeAKqKrs
value 7677183
address 18Mssc7Df6WdJ1YKsQbWujJepY3K8xmS5n